Linux下搭建redis集群(简单例子)

首先复制redis的bin
cp redis/bin redis-cluster/redis01 -r

增加可执行权限

因为我们搭建集群的时候,它必须是一个干净的节点,不能有数据,否则它会报上面那个错误
解决办法如下:
Linux下搭建redis集群(简单例子)_第1张图片
删掉这俩个文件就可以了
[root@fanbin redis-cluster]# rm -rf redis*/dump.rdb
[root@fanbin redis-cluster]# rm -rf redis*/nodes.conf
删完后,需要重新启动服务
Linux下搭建redis集群(简单例子)_第2张图片
创建集群成功
使用客户端连接任意一个端口的集群就可以
注意下面的C是必不可少的
因为如果不加-c的话,在我们的节点之间跳转是失败的
redis01/redis-cli -p 7001 -c
Linux下搭建redis集群(简单例子)_第3张图片
注意连接集群
Linux下搭建redis集群(简单例子)_第4张图片
就这些了,希望可以帮到大家!





你可能感兴趣的:(Linux)